Cape Town International Convention Centre

Type: Convention Centres
Completion: 2003
Size: 20 000 m²
Client: City of Cape Town

– 2004 SAPOA Award for Innovation Excellence

SVA International formed part of Foreshore Architects, the consortium that deliverd the Cape Town International Convention Centre.

The CTICC was designed as an iconic development for Cape Town’s CBD, close to the V&A Waterfront. Completed in 2003, it has become a highly successful conference, exhibition and events venue.

In addition to an adjoining 450 room hotel, the convention centre includes:

• 11 000 m² of exhibition space with 33 breakout rooms.
• Sub-divisible, multi-functional 2000m² ballroom.
• Two auditoria seating 1500 and 610 guests respectively.
• Restaurants, catering facilities, and coffee shops.

The Cape Town International Convention Centre has won a number of awards including the 2004 SAPOA Award for Innovation Excellence.
